      I would 99% of the time take the cubic inches. So many people are into the destroke idea but RPM capability has a lot to do with valvetrain stability more than bottom end. Look at LS engines for comparison. 6.2-7.0 liter LS engines make better power than 4.8-5.3 engines but the architecture is nearly the same.

      Don’t feel like you have to go LS. Traditional V8’s can work very well and, IMO, it’s nicer buying things like radiator hoses and other parts that were originally designed for your car and bolt in. Do what feels right for yourself. Big Blocks are awesome just as LS engines are.
